Output 4c118a54ac9126481186388fef188b53dbc757c4e6ec60dd164537e6ac4e42a8:123

value
250124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fca6733e07773776f58bdff4864de3cb5e6e591 OP_EQUAL
address
3Bt7Q43caVhtC47w7JrMLZb9Hf4Egd7UZa
transaction
4c118a54ac9126481186388fef188b53dbc757c4e6ec60dd164537e6ac4e42a8
confirmations
234015
spent
true